Single vehicle crash with minor injuries on I-40 near 98thAlbuquerque NM

audio iconTraffic
I-40, Albuquerque, NM

Fire and rescue responded to a single vehicle accident on I-40 near 98th. The vehicle had moderate damage. The occupant was out of the vehicle and reported to have minor injuries.
